Why is Philly so dirty?

Philly’s evolving up-and-coming neighborhoods blur sectional boundaries, contributing to where the litter is concentrated. “Many of the problems stem from the fact that nice areas and not-so-nice areas are all right on top of each other.

Is NYC or Philly safer?

Out of America’s ten largest cities, the murder rate in its safest city (New York) is less than a quarter of the murder rate in its most dangerous large city (Philadelphia), with 5.1 murders per 100,000 compared to 21.5.

What US city has the highest crime rate?

The most dangerous city in the United States is Detroit, Michigan. Detroit has a violent crime rate of 2,007.8 incidents per 100,000 people with a total of 261 homicides in 2018. Detroit is the only midsize or large city in the United States with a violent crime rate of over 2,000.

Is Philadelphia trashy?

Forbes and other magazines have called Philadelphia one of the nation’s dirtiest cities, but those rankings took into account air quality and water pollution. Experts say it’s difficult to isolate trash as a single factor and accurately compare cities. Philadelphia officials say the city is getting cleaner.
